Satellite-based Navigation System


A satellite-based navigation system is a system that uses satellites to provide autonomous geo-spatial positioning with global coverage. These systems use a network of satellites to provide precise location and timing information to receivers on the ground, sea, or air. The most widely known satellite-based navigation system is the Global Positioning System (GPS), which is operated by the United States government. Other satellite-based navigation systems include the Russian GLONASS, the European Galileo, and the Chinese BeiDou. These systems are used in various maritime applications, such as navigation, search and rescue, and vessel traffic management.
